The Saudi Arabia AI Pathology Market is valued at USD 450 million, based on a five-year historical analysis. Growth is primarily driven by the increasing adoption of digital health technologies, rising prevalence of chronic and genetic diseases, and the need for efficient diagnostic solutions. The integration of artificial intelligence in pathology is enhancing diagnostic accuracy, enabling remote consultations, and reducing turnaround times, making it a vital component of modern healthcare. The market is further propelled by public and private investments in healthcare infrastructure modernization, regulatory approval of digital systems, and the need for scalable, remote solutions in regions with pathologist shortages.

Key cities such as Riyadh, Jeddah, and Dammam dominate the market due to their advanced healthcare infrastructure and concentration of medical facilities. These urban centers are home to leading hospitals and research institutions that are increasingly adopting AI technologies to improve patient outcomes, streamline operations, and support multi-site collaboration through digital pathology platforms.

The Artificial Intelligence in Healthcare Regulation, 2023, issued by the Saudi Food and Drug Authority (SFDA), mandates the integration of AI technologies in healthcare systems to enhance diagnostic capabilities. This regulation requires healthcare providers to adopt certified AI-based diagnostic tools, ensure compliance with data privacy standards, and maintain ongoing performance monitoring of AI systems, thereby improving the quality of healthcare services and aligning with global best practices.

Saudi Arabia AI Pathology Market Segmentation

By Type:

The market is segmented into Digital Pathology Solutions, AI-Driven Diagnostic Tools, Image Analysis Software, Workflow Management Systems, AI-Powered Cancer Detection Platforms, and Others. Digital Pathology Solutions are gaining significant traction due to their ability to digitize and analyze pathology slides, facilitating remote consultations and improving diagnostic accuracy. AI-Driven Diagnostic Tools are also increasingly popular, enhancing the speed and precision of disease detection, particularly in oncology and chronic disease management. Image Analysis Software and Workflow Management Systems are being adopted to streamline laboratory operations and support high-throughput diagnostics, while AI-Powered Cancer Detection Platforms are contributing to early and accurate cancer diagnosis.

By End-User:

The end-user segmentation includes Hospitals, Diagnostic Laboratories, Research Institutions, Academic Medical Centers, Private Clinics, and Others. Hospitals are the leading end-users, driven by the need for advanced diagnostic tools to improve patient care and operational efficiency. Diagnostic Laboratories also play a crucial role as they require high-throughput solutions for accurate and timely test results, particularly in cancer diagnostics. Research Institutions and Academic Medical Centers are adopting AI pathology solutions for clinical research and education, while Private Clinics and Others are gradually integrating these technologies to enhance service quality.

Saudi Arabia AI Pathology Market Industry Analysis

Growth Drivers

Increasing Prevalence of Chronic Diseases:

The rise in chronic diseases such as diabetes and cancer in Saudi Arabia is a significant growth driver for the AI pathology market. According to the Saudi Ministry of Health, approximately

4.2 million people are living with diabetes, and cancer cases are projected to reach

20,000 by in future. This increasing burden necessitates advanced diagnostic solutions, propelling the demand for AI-driven pathology tools that can enhance early detection and treatment outcomes.

Advancements in AI Technology:

The rapid evolution of AI technologies, including machine learning and deep learning, is transforming pathology practices in Saudi Arabia. In in future, the country is expected to invest over

SAR 1 billion in AI healthcare technologies, facilitating the development of sophisticated diagnostic tools. These advancements enable pathologists to analyze complex data sets more efficiently, improving diagnostic accuracy and reducing turnaround times, which is crucial for effective patient management.

Government Initiatives for Healthcare Digitization:

The Saudi government is actively promoting healthcare digitization through initiatives like the National Transformation Program. This program aims to enhance healthcare services by integrating digital technologies, with an allocated budget of SAR 2.5 billion for health IT projects. Such initiatives are expected to foster the adoption of AI pathology solutions, as healthcare facilities increasingly seek to modernize their diagnostic capabilities and improve patient care.

Market Challenges

High Initial Investment Costs:

One of the primary challenges facing the AI pathology market in Saudi Arabia is the high initial investment required for implementing AI technologies. The cost of advanced diagnostic equipment and software can exceed SAR 500,000 per unit, which may deter smaller healthcare facilities from adopting these solutions. This financial barrier limits the widespread integration of AI in pathology, hindering overall market growth and innovation.

Limited Awareness Among Healthcare Professionals:

There is a notable lack of awareness and understanding of AI technologies among healthcare professionals in Saudi Arabia. A survey conducted by the Saudi Health Council revealed that only 30% of pathologists are familiar with AI applications in diagnostics. This knowledge gap can impede the adoption of AI pathology solutions, as professionals may be hesitant to trust or utilize unfamiliar technologies in their practice, affecting patient outcomes.

Market Opportunities

Expansion of Telemedicine Services:

The rise of telemedicine in Saudi Arabia presents a unique opportunity for AI pathology solutions. With the telemedicine market projected to reach

SAR 1.2 billion by in future, integrating AI diagnostics can enhance remote consultations, allowing pathologists to provide timely and accurate assessments, ultimately improving patient access to quality healthcare services.

Collaborations with Tech Companies:

Collaborations between healthcare providers and technology firms can drive innovation in AI pathology. By leveraging expertise from tech companies, healthcare institutions can develop localized AI solutions tailored to the specific needs of the Saudi market. Such partnerships can enhance diagnostic capabilities and foster the development of cutting-edge tools that address local healthcare challenges effectively.
